Output 0677d6313aebd2c57033e45fc0047c95277b946fed4e1e71d9bfc82d57f342f7:26

value
1208998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130ed8021bbb08e2ffb549e07ed63ea2a4f4f238 OP_EQUAL
address
33RnYZ1CAHbNrPgGdQZd4t9Teu3Bvkp2Jn
transaction
0677d6313aebd2c57033e45fc0047c95277b946fed4e1e71d9bfc82d57f342f7
spent
true